Manufacturing defect
A problem introduced during production that causes a battery to perform poorly or fail.
Safety risk in batteries
Serious problems like internal short circuits and thermal runaway caused by manufacturing defects.
Reliability problem
Issues such as low capacity, high self-discharge, and rapid aging in batteries.
Materials defects
Defects in incoming materials like powders, additives, and electrolytes.
Process defects
Defects occurring during manufacturing processes like coating non-uniformity and poor drying.
Assembly defects
Problems occurring during the assembly of the battery, such as improper sealing.
Formation/aging defects
Defects related to abnormal formation processes and aging of batteries.
Symptoms
Observed problems in testing that indicate a defect.
Root causes
The underlying reasons for the observed symptoms.
Corrective action
An immediate fix to address a defect.
Preventive action
Changes made to prevent the recurrence of a defect.
D-C-A-P mnemonic
Detect, Contain, Analyze, Prevent – a methodical approach to troubleshooting.
Swelling
An increase in size due to gas generation, often a sign of gas buildup in batteries.
Control charts
Statistical tools to monitor process stability and identify special cause variations.
Common-cause variation
Stable variation in a controlled process, expected during normal operation.
Special-cause variation
Abnormal variation due to specific issues like contamination or parameter shifts.
Quality Control (QC)
Operational techniques to verify that a product meets required specifications.
Quality System (QMS)
An organized framework that ensures quality is maintained and improved.
Specifications
Defined requirements for characteristics such as resistance, mass, and leak rates.
Acceptance Criteria
Rules determining pass/fail based on measurements and uncertainty.
Incoming quality control (IQC)
Verification of materials before entering production.
In-process quality control (IPQC)
Monitoring critical manufacturing steps to detect process drift.
Final quality control (FQC)
Verification of finished products against electrical and safety-related requirements.
Traceability
The ability to trace a product back through its production history.
Nonconformance control
Management of deviations from requirements within a quality system.
Change control
Approval processes necessary for changes in materials or processes.
Corrective and Preventive Action (CAPA)
Processes to address existing issues and prevent future occurrences.
Audits
Reviews to check compliance with the quality system and identify areas for improvement.
